Anatomy of 105 Pull-Ups: What Those Numbers Mean
Listing sets and totals gives a raw measure of work, but unpacking what 105 pull-ups entails clarifies the physiological demands.
- Weighted vs. Bodyweight: Adding 10 kg for 40 repetitions shifts the emphasis toward maximal strength and increased time under tension. Weighted pull-ups recruit higher-threshold motor units and stimulate strength and hypertrophy in the latissimus dorsi, biceps, forearms and scapular stabilizers. Doing 40 reps with added weight in a session is a significant strength endurance challenge.
- Volume and Endurance: Completing 60 additional bodyweight pull-ups highlights muscular endurance and recovery between sets. The body must repeatedly overcome full body mass; metabolic stress accumulates rapidly, especially in the forearms and grip.
- Morning Set (“5 just to wake up”): A small, high-intent set performed early primes motor patterns and nervous system activation. Athletes often use low-volume, high-quality repetitions to cue neuromuscular readiness without generating excessive fatigue.
Taken together, the sequence trains multiple qualities: strength (weighted reps), mid-range hypertrophy and endurance (high-volume bodyweight), and neuromuscular activation (the small wake-up set). For a performer, these adaptations translate into stronger pulling strength for aerial stunts, smoother execution of choreographed sequences that rely on grappling or climbing, and the ability to repeat takes without dramatic fatigue.
Programming: How Bodyweight and Strength Training Complement Each Other
Vishal’s description — “a combination of bodyweight training and strength work to build overall fitness and endurance” — reflects a deliberate, blended approach. Both modalities serve distinct but complementary roles.
- Bodyweight Training: Pull-ups, dips, push-ups and pistol squats develop relative strength and movement-specific endurance. These movements improve control of one’s own mass, enhance joint stability and translate well to stunt choreography that lacks machine assistance.
- Strength Work: Barbell rows, deadlifts, weighted pull-ups and bent-over lifts drive absolute strength. Increasing absolute strength allows the performer to control heavier external loads and improves power output. In the context of film action, increased absolute strength makes it safer and more convincing to handle props, partners, or resistive forces.
A typical weekly plan for a role might alternate focus days: a strength emphasis (lower reps, heavier weight), a hypertrophy day (moderate reps, controlled pacing), and a conditioning day (higher reps, metabolic stress, circuit-style work). Recovery days and mobility sessions punctuate the week to sustain performance and limit injury risk.
Progressive overload — the systematic increase of workload over time — sits at the core. For an actor preparing over one and a half months, progressive overload might mean increasing total reps weekly, increasing the amount of added weight for weighted pull-ups, decreasing rest between sets, or improving set quality (e.g., more strict reps, less kipping).

Calluses, Blisters and Grip: The Visible Currency of Work
The image of callused hands is a small but powerful signal. Calluses form as the skin responds to repeated friction and pressure; while not glamorous, they reflect volume and specificity of work. Yet they also pose management challenges.
- Grip Fatigue: High-volume pull-ups fatigue the grip early, often becoming the limiting factor before larger pulling muscles fail. Training needs to include grip-specific work (farmer carries, plate pinches, dead hangs) and technique adjustments to avoid overreliance on finger endurance.
- Callus Management: Unmanaged calluses can tear during a take, causing bleeding and disruption. Athletes and performers use pumice, file down calluses, apply protective balms, and in some cases use tape to reduce tearing risk.
- Blisters and Skin Integrity: Blisters indicate acute friction. Preventive measures include chalk for moisture control, gloves in training (though many prefer not to for technique), and gradual increase in volume to allow skin adaptation.
Visible hand damage signals both commitment and a need to manage skin, sensation and pain thresholds carefully. Film sets require functional hands; a torn callus can derail a critical sequence. Trainers and actors strike a balance: enough volume to adapt but not so much that it triggers avoidable injuries.
Nutrition and Recovery: The Unseen Half of Transformation
Training creates stimulus; nutrition and recovery convert that stimulus into change. For someone accruing muscle mass and enduring heavy sessions, dietary strategies and recovery protocols are not optional.
- Caloric Needs: Building muscle while sustaining high-volume conditioning requires a caloric surplus or at least maintenance calories with fine-tuned macronutrients. Protein intake supports muscle protein synthesis; carbohydrates replenish glycogen for repeated sessions.
- Protein Distribution: Regular protein intake throughout the day optimizes muscle repair. For role preparation, many actors aim for a calculated protein intake based on body weight and training load.
- Hydration and Electrolytes: Sweating in intensive workouts affects performance and recovery. Electrolyte balance influences neuromuscular function and endurance, particularly in repeated multi-set pull-up sessions.
- Sleep and Autonomic Balance: Sleep is the primary time for hormonal recovery and memory consolidation of motor patterns. Quality sleep reduces cortisol flare-ups and supports muscle recovery.
- Therapeutic Modalities: Massage, targeted physiotherapy sessions, cold water immersion or contrast therapy and active recovery days help manage microtrauma and maintain range of motion.
A condensed six-week window for notable change implies meticulous attention to these factors. Without disciplined recovery, gains dry up, and injury risk rises.

Context: Vishal Jethwa’s Career and Why This Shift Matters
Vishal Jethwa’s rise from television historical drama to mainstream films created a platform across genres. His notable roles include playing Akbar in Bharat Ka Veer Putra: Maharana Pratap, portraying Sunny in Mardaani 2, and acting alongside Kajol and Aneet Padda in Salaam Venky. Most recently, he appeared in Homebound, directed by Neeraj Ghaywan, which was among 15 films shortlisted for the 98th Academy Awards’ Best International Feature Film list, though it did not secure a nomination.
These roles illustrate range: period drama, crime-thriller sensibility, and mainstream features that demand both nuanced acting and, increasingly, physical credibility. Training Details: Typical Methods for Building Pull Strength and Endurance
Breaking down practical training elements helps explain how an actor moves from baseline to being able to complete 105 pull-ups in a session.
- Baseline Testing: Establish maximum reps in a set, weighted one-rep max approximations for pulling movements, grip endurance tests, and scapular control checks.
- Progressive Programming:
- Phase 1 (Weeks 1–2): Build movement quality; emphasize scapular pull-ups, negative-only reps, band-assisted pull-ups, and grip drills. Focus on volume but keep intensity moderate to build tolerance.
- Phase 2 (Weeks 3–4): Increase intensity; introduce weighted pull-ups, reduce assistance, and layer metabolic conditioning circuits. Begin to simulate on-set conditions with quick turnover between sets.
- Phase 3 (Weeks 5–6): Peak phase; perform heavier weighted sets, test multiple sets to failure with controlled rest, and sharpen neuromuscular recruitment with explosive concentric work (e.g., clap pull-ups or high-intent concentric reps) while carefully managing fatigue.
- Accessory Work: Rows (barbell, dumbbell, cable), face pulls, rotator cuff strengthening, core bracing exercises, and posterior chain conditioning to balance anterior-pushing work.
- Conditioning Integration: Sprints, sled pushes/pulls, battle ropes, and circuit training to maintain cardiovascular capacity without sacrificing strength.
- Deloading: Scheduled light weeks to allow recovery and consolidation of gains.
These elements combined produce the capacity to do high-volume pull-up sessions while preserving joint health and performance quality.
Grip Training: Often Overlooked, Always Limiting
Grip is often the rate-limiting factor in pulling-focused sessions. Three strategies mitigate grip failure:
- Specificity: Farmer walks, plate pinches, thick-bar deadlifts, and dead hangs strengthen relevant muscles directly for the task.
- Variation: Using fat grips increases forearm engagement; wrist curls and reverse wrist curls strengthen finger flexors and extensors for balance.
- Technique: Learning to engage the lat and core efficiently reduces reliance on the fingers. Proper cueing — packing the shoulders, initiating pull with the scapula — shifts load distribution.
For a performer, grip resilience not only supports pulling mechanics but also improves safety when executing harnessed stunts, partner work and prop manipulation.
Managing Risk: Injury Prevention and On-Set Contingencies
High-volume training increases accumulator fatigue and risk. Preventive steps reduce the odds of training setbacks that could influence production schedules.
- Prehab and Mobility: Daily shoulder mobility work, targeted rotator cuff care, and thoracic mobility maintain range of motion and resilience under load.
- Load Monitoring: Tracking session rate of perceived exertion (RPE), tracking sleep, and adjusting loads when stress markers rise prevents overtraining.
- Integrating Stunt Team Feedback: Stunt coordinators evaluate movements in the context of choreography. Training should include rehearsal with stunt partners to ensure technique translates to staged combat without placing joints at risk.
- Medical Oversight: Access to physiotherapists for ongoing assessment allows early intervention when minor issues arise.
Film productions run on tight timelines; an injury during training that delays shooting imposes high costs. Robust prevention strategies protect both the actor’s health and the production schedule.
